What Chicago's Environment Does to Water Heaters
The lake moderates summer warmth a little bit, but it likewise pulls moisture right into autumn and springtime. Winters are cool and prolonged, and the chilly water entering your heater can run 35 to 45 levels Fahrenheit. That vast delta from inlet to setpoint temperature level suggests your heating unit functions harder for even more months of the year. Gas versions cycle more frequently. Electric components run longer sessions. Tankless devices are pressed to the top edge of their circulation rankings when two components open at once.
Hard water substances the anxiety. Lots of Chicago areas examination at modest to high solidity, which speeds up scale build-up on electric components and gas-fired heat transfer surfaces. I have actually drained containers where the bottom six inches were obstructed with crispy mineral debris, reducing reliable capability and covering up thermostat concerns. Cold air infiltration is an additional offender, particularly in basements with older single-pane home windows or breezy bulkhead doors. Burning appliances need air, but way too much unrestrained air cools the storage tank and flue, boosts condensation, and triggers recurring flame-sensing faults.
If your water heater is near an outside wall or in a garage, the impacts show up earlier. Burners rust. Vent ports drip. Condensate swimming pools where it shouldn't. Prepare for assessment and solution cadence that appreciates these realities. A heater that would run 8 to 10 years in a light climate might need attention by year six here.
How to Area Trouble Prior To It Spikes
Most failings provide cautions. You simply need to recognize them and act. A few field notes:
A warm water supply that turns from cozy to hot and back recommends a falling short thermostat or stopped up blending shutoff. On gas systems, irregular temperature frequently starts after sediment has blanketed the bottom, producing locations that perplex the control.
Popping, roaring, or a gravelly sound throughout heater cycles generally indicates scale and debris. The sound is heavy steam standing out below layers of mineral buildup, which also steals effectiveness. In worst cases the grumbling trembles apart dip tubes and anode rods.
Rust-tinted hot water that clears after a few mins usually suggests an anode pole has been taken in and the tank is starting to wear away. If the discoloration appears on both cold and hot, look upstream at the structure's piping, yet don't disregard the heating unit without pulling the anode for inspection.
Drips near the temperature and pressure safety valve can be misleading. If the shutoff weeps just during a home heating cycle after that stops, thermal expansion might be driving stress past the valve's limit. Chicago homes with shut systems or examine valves on the water meter usually need an effectively sized growth storage tank. If the valve cries frequently, replace it and examination system pressure.
Intermittent hot water on a tankless unit when you open a single low-flow tap can show the minimum circulation sensing unit isn't being set off. Mineral scale in the warmth exchanger is an usual reason. Do not maintain raising the temperature level to make up, you'll develop a scald threat and still obtain warm water.
Gas scent, burn marks, or residue around the heater compartment implies closed it down and call a professional. In older cellars with dust and pet hair, I often find fire rollout evidence from stopped up burning air intakes.

Repair or Replace: The Actual Equation
I do not make use of a strict age cutoff, yet age matters. The majority of standard glass-lined containers last 8 to 12 years when sensibly preserved. In devices with overlooked anodes or extreme water problems, 6 to 8 years prevails. At the 10-year mark, despite a clean burner and sound controls, interior tank wear ends up being the coin toss you won't like. If the container itself leaks, replacement is non-negotiable. No sealant or epoxy is more than a short-lived bandage.
For repair candidates, I check out component costs, accessibility, and anticipated horizon. Replacing gas control shutoffs, thermocouples, igniters, or thermostats frequently makes sense for more youthful devices. So does switching a failed heating element on an electric version. Anode poles are affordable insurance, water heater chicago and I have actually changed them on tanks as old as year 9 when the inside still looked respectable. Yet if the burner setting up is worn away, the flue baffle is distorted, or you can't separate the leak without pressurizing, I push house owners toward replacement.
Efficiency gains commonly tip the balance. Newer gas or hybrid electric designs use much less power per gallon supplied, and tankless units have actually enhanced regulating controls that respond better to Chicago's chilly inlet water. If your existing heating unit is undersized, changing with the appropriate capacity or a tankless system solves both dependability and comfort.
Sizing for Real-life Chicago Use
A well-sized system does not go after peak draw, it satisfies it without losing gas the other 23 hours. Sizing obtains trickier when a home has an older whirlpool tub, a multi-head shower, or a cellar house with an extra bath.
For storage tanks, complete shower room count, occupancy, and fixture practices drive the option. A family of four with two complete bathrooms and common morning overlap rarely is sorry for a 50-gallon gas container if the recovery rate is solid. A 40-gallon version can help disciplined routines, yet if both showers run and washing starts, maps.app.goo.gl water heater repair chicago it will fail. Electric containers require bigger capacities to match the recovery of gas. I frequently spec 65 to 80 gallons for all-electric homes with two or even more baths.
For tankless, match the device to the coldest expected incoming temperature and simultaneous circulation. In Chicago winters months, prepare for a temperature level increase of 70 to 85 degrees. 2 showers plus a sink may need 6 to 8 gallons per min at that rise. Producers list circulation capability at specific delta-T values. Review those tables, not just the headline GPM. If room enables, some two-flats gain from two smaller sized tankless units in parallel as opposed to one extra-large system, which boosts redundancy and modulates extra successfully on reduced draws.
Gas, Electric, Crossbreed, or Tankless: Making a Long Lasting Choice
There is no universally ideal option. Your gas line size, airing vent path, electric capability, and space format identify what's practical. After that the mathematics of power costs and your usage patterns finish the picture.
Traditional gas storage tank hot water heater being in the sweet area of price, uncomplicated setup, and trustworthy recuperation. They know to examiners and solution technologies. If you have a suitable chimney or a direct-vent course, they work well in most Chicago basements. They are sensitive to makeup air and venting problem, which is why you should inspect the flue regularly for rust or ice dams near the cap.
High-efficiency gas with power air vent or condensing layouts uses PVC venting and can be extra effective, specifically when you can not rely upon a stonework chimney. They need an appropriate condensate drainpipe line that will not freeze. The vent runs must be pitched to drain, and the termination must be sited to avoid snow drift zones.
Electric tanks are simpler mechanically, without any combustion or airing vent to stress over. They can be outstanding in apartments or buildings without gas. The trade-off is recovery speed and electric load. If your panel is maxed out currently, including a big electric heating system might compel a solution upgrade.
Hybrid heatpump hot water heater shine in detached homes with sufficient space and light ambient temperatures. They pull heat from the surrounding air and are really reliable. In Chicago basements, they still function, yet they cool and evaporate the area. That can be an advantage in summertime, a downside in winter months. Clearances, condensate handling, and noise issue, particularly if the unit is near a living area. I have actually installed hybrids in laundry rooms where the dryer's waste warmth aids, yet in little mechanical wardrobes they can struggle.
Tankless gas systems maximize floor area and supply countless hot water within their flow limits. They are sensitive to water quality and call for regular descaling. Venting is commonly secured and sidewall-terminated, which usually simplifies flue problems. They do need appropriate gas supply, often upsizing the line to 3/4 inch or larger. Properly installed and kept, they last a long period of time and maintain expenses predictable.
Chicago Building Truths: Venting, Permits, and Access
Venting is where lots of do it yourself efforts go laterally. Older two-flats and bungalows frequently share a smokeshaft flue between the water heater and a climatic heating system. If the heating system obtains replaced with a high-efficiency model that airs vent via PVC, the water heater ends up alone in a too-large chimney. That changes draft characteristics and threats condensation inside the masonry. I have actually gauged flue gas temperature levels that drop too quickly, merging acidic condensate in linings. If you go this course, consider an appropriately sized steel lining or switch the heater to a power-vent or direct-vent model.
Chicago's allowing process for water heater installment is uncomplicated when you adhere to code and supply fundamental documents. Expect gas pressure tests for brand-new or altered lines, burning air estimations if you are sticking with atmospheric devices, and inspection of TPR discharge piping. In older structures, examiners also check out bonding and grounding of metal water lines. Scheduling is less complicated midweek and outdoors holiday weeks. If your structure is a condominium, consider board approvals and elevator bookings for relocating tanks.
Access forms labor time. Yard devices with narrow gangways and reduced stairwell transforms restriction tank dimension simply because you can't literally steer a larger cyndrical tube. I have actually had jobs where a 50-gallon tank needed to be taken apart to remove, after that we shifted to a tankless to avoid future gain access to headaches. Action doorways, turns, and ceiling elevations before you decide on a model.
Maintenance That In fact Expands Life
Yearly solution defeats surprise failures. In our environment, the adhering to cadence jobs. Drain pipes a few gallons from the storage tank every 6 months to purge sediment. Complete flushes are suitable if the valve is durable, yet I have seen old plastic drain valves snap. If the valve feels lightweight, a partial drainpipe and refill is more secure. On electrical containers, kill power first and examine component resistance with a multimeter while you're there.
Inspect and change the anode rod every 2 to 3 years. In high-hardness locations, magnesium anodes dissolve rapidly. An aluminum-zinc anode can reduce smell issues from sulfur germs and lasts a bit much longer. If you do not have overhanging clearance, make use of a segmented anode. When anodes are ignored, the tank becomes the sacrificial steel, and failing accelerates.
For gas models, vacuum dust and lint from the heater area. Tidy flame-sensing poles carefully with a fine abrasive pad. Examine that the fire is secure and mainly blue with distinct cones. Careless yellow flames indicate inadequate burning or obstructed air. Verify that the draft hood is drawing by holding a smoke source near it while the heater runs. If smoke spills out, quit and address venting.
Tankless units need yearly descaling in the majority of Chicago communities. Use a pump, hose pipes, and a descaling option to distribute via the warmth exchanger. Tidy inlet filters. Validate the condensate neutralizer media is still reliable on condensing designs. I have seen overlooked tankless devices keep up half the anticipated circulation due to the fact that the exchanger was lined with mineral crust.
Expansion tanks are worthy of a stress check too. With the system cold and pressure happy, the growth container's air side need to match your home's fixed water pressure, generally 50 to 60 psi. A waterlogged development storage tank produces annoyance TPR discharges and reduces the life of shutoffs and gaskets downstream.
When To Call for Professional Hot Water Heater Service in Chicago
Some troubles are secure to explore yourself, like checking the breaker, relighting a pilot per the handbook, or flushing debris. Others warrant a pro. Gas leaks, flue backdrafting, scorch marks, and repeating TPR discharges drop in that classification. So do new electric runs for hybrid or huge electrical tanks and any type of adjustment to gas lines.
A good solution visit isn't just a quick swap of a component. Anticipate a tech to examine gas pressure, clock the meter if required, determine combustion or component present, verify draft, and evaluate for indications of moisture. Realistic Expense Varies and What Drives Them
Costs vary by accessibility, brand name, service warranty, and code needs. An uncomplicated repair like a thermocouple or igniter on a gas container may land in a moderate range, while a control shutoff or electric element could be higher. Complete water heater installment in Chicago for a conventional climatic gas container generally consists of the device, new flex ports, drip leg, TPR piping to code, license, and haul-away of the old tank. Add costs for a brand-new smokeshaft lining if required, or for a power-vent version with long air vent runs and condensate drain configuration.
Tankless installations have a wider spread. If the gas line have to be upsized and the vent route pierced with stonework with a long run, the labor increases. Descaling valves and isolation packages add price in advance but save running expense later. Hybrid heatpump set you back greater than common electric tanks, and you might require a condensate pump, vibration isolation pads, and perhaps a tiny duct set to maximize airflow.
Ask for made a list of quotes so you can see where the money goes. Low bids that omit permit charges, airing vent upgrades, or expansion storage tanks typically balloon later on or cause a system that functions poorly.

What I 'd Advise in Common Chicago Scenarios
In an older block bungalow with an audio smokeshaft and a family members of four, a 50-gallon climatic gas tank stays a reputable, affordable option, provided the chimney is lined and the basement isn't starved for air. Include an appropriately sized expansion container and schedule yearly flushes.
In a garden device with restricted accessibility and only one bathroom, a small tankless can vacuum and deal with 2 components simultaneously if sized properly for winter inlet water. Plan a descaling routine and set up seclusion valves from day one.
In an apartment without gas, an 80-gallon electric container offers comfy recovery if the panel can sustain it. If the wardrobe is tight and you want efficiency, a crossbreed heat pump works if you approve a cooler closet and configure condensate correctly. I have actually seen citizens value the dehumidification effect in summer.
For two-flat owners who provide hot water to renters, redundancy matters. 2 medium tankless devices in parallel with a controller give adaptability. If one falls short, the various other maintains basic solution while you wait for parts. This setup additionally regulates far better at reduced need than a single oversized unit.
Seasonal Tips That Pay Off
Before the first tough freeze, stroll the exterior. If your heater vents via a sidewall, inspect the termination for insect nests or debris. Confirm the termination is high enough over grade to avoid snow obstruction. Inside, confirm that the condensate lines on power-vent or condensing units are sloped and that traps have water to avoid exhaust recirculation.
During long cold wave, pay attention for new rattles or modifications in heater noise. Unexpected rises in burner noise or prolonged shooting cycles typically associate flue limitations or heavy sediment activity. On extremely windy days, sidewall-vented units can short-cycle from pressure disruptions near the air vent. Proper vent termination positioning minimizes this; including a wind-resistant cap can help.
In springtime, humidity climbs up and basement moisture increases. Check for rust on copper-to-steel changes and at the nipples in addition to the container. I usually see very early corrosion at these joints from small sweating, not from leakages. A simple wipe-down and assessment regular when a month informs you a lot.
What Makes a Good Installation, Not Just a Brand-new Heater
A cool mount is greater than tidy piping. It suggests right burning air computations, vent pitch, gas sizing, dielectric isolation in between different steels, and a drip leg on the gas line. It indicates the TPR discharge does not run uphill which the pan under the heating unit, if utilized, has a drainpipe to somewhere that can deal with water. It likewise suggests sensible discussion concerning water quality. In some homes, a point-of-entry softener can add years to the system. In others, an easy range inhibitor cartridge upstream of a tankless unit is enough.
Documentation issues. Keep your authorization, design numbers, guarantee information, and a fundamental service log. When you call for water heater repair service in Chicago years later, handing a tech those notes saves diagnostic time and lowers billable hours.

What are the 4 types of water heaters?
The four main types of water heaters are tank (storage) heaters, tankless (on-demand) heaters, heat pump water heaters, and solar water heaters. Tank heaters store heated water, while tankless units heat water on demand. Heat pumps and solar models use energy-efficient methods for heating water.
How many years will a water heater last?
The lifespan of a water heater depends on its type and maintenance. Tank water heaters typically last 8 to 12 years, while tankless models can last 15 to 20 years. Regular maintenance can extend the life of any water heater.
